Nippon Steel Corporation, Japan’s largest steelmaker and a global industry leader, has partnered with TIER IV, Inc., a trailblazer in open-source autonomous driving technology, to transform steel transportation. This collaboration focuses on deploying heavy-duty autonomous vehicles at Nippon Steel’s Nagoya plant by fiscal 2025, aiming to address labor shortages while boosting plant safety and operational efficiency. Since fiscal 2023, the two companies have been combining their expertise to pioneer innovative solutions for the steel industry’s logistical challenges.

The partnership tackles a critical issue in the steel sector: a shrinking workforce. Nippon Steel is automating its specialized transporters, which move pallets loaded with steel plates, to streamline operations and reduce accident risks. By integrating TIER IV’s advanced technology, the company aims to create a safer and more efficient working environment. This initiative aligns with Nippon Steel’s broader digital transformation strategy, emphasizing innovation to maintain its competitive edge.
TIER IV brings its expertise through Autoware, the world’s first open-source autonomous driving software. The company provides reference designs tailored specifically for steel transportation, ensuring the vehicles can navigate the complex layout of a steel plant. This customization is key to the project’s success, merging cutting-edge technology with industrial practicality.
